The Resin Injection Process Explained
Resin injection is a controlled process used to fill hidden voids. In essence:
- A fluid resin is introduced carefully into weakened soil zones.
- As it reacts, it bonds with existing materials.
- The technique re-levels structures without major excavation.
- It’s often considered a “no-dig” or “minimal disruption” alternative to underpinning.
- Many projects are carried out with minimal downtime.
By working directly within the soil or structure, resin injection prevents further movement while maintaining the property’s appearance and reducing site disruption.

Signs You May Need Resin Injection
You may need resin injection if you notice any of the following:
Cracks in walls or ceilings
Movement under footfall
Gaps forming around doors and windows
Separated skirting or cornices
Localised sinking around foundations

Why Choose Resin Over Traditional Methods
This modern technique provides several benefits over older, more invasive approaches:
Low-disturbance installation — properties stay in operation with short on-site time.
Quick-setting technology — often completed overnight.
Precision targeting — treat individual voids or weak spots without unnecessary disruption.
Anti-moisture protection — helps prevent future deterioration.
Low added mass — ideal for areas with limited load tolerance.
Efficient and economical — thanks to lower downtime.
In most cases, the finished outcome restores strength and stability for years to come.
